Peter Powers - Glasgow 19 February 2011
Caught the latest shows by Peter Powers in Glasgow. He generally does the Pavilion Theatre for a few weekends every six months and as with any long-running hypnotist the shows (and volunteers) can be variable. Thankfully this was one of the better shows.
I attended the event with another member from the site and one of his friends who ended up volunteering for the 7.30 pm slot and of course became the star of the show. We'd done some private hypno before the show so I don't know whether that led to him ending up on stage because beforehand he wasn't sure if he wanted to take part.
Peter tends to mix up his routines and introduce the occasional new sketch as well. The show had had a major revamp last summer and the so the format was fairly similar to his July shows. It was interesting to hear what happens during the interval as I always wondered what happened behind the curtain - he focuses on deepeners with the volunteers so that they can maintain the trance in the second half. I think this is a new element to his shows because in the past he would have lost a lot of volunteers during the interval but on both occasions all volunteers from the first half remained on stage for the second. The midnight show hadn't been as wild as I expected but two of the (male) volunteers did end up doing the complete full monty. Interesting to see that some of the volunteers were rejecting suggestions even though there were quite deeply hypnotised - something I've encountered myself.
